Celebrating diversity: Music
By Peter Baldock of the Cultural Mentoring Service,
Nursery World,
27 October 2005
Apart from food, music is the most common way in which most British people encounter other cultures. It is enjoyable and that makes it less challenging - something that is an advantage and a disadvantage in equal proportions. Children in your setting will enjoy listening to other cultures' music.
